Our Radar's reporting teams in Nassarawa state have observed
serious voter intimidation at the polling units in many of the wards in the State,
with many people unable to vote as a result.
Armed APC supporters descended on polling units, forcing
many would-be voters to flee the scene. Here is a text from an APGA agent
“Good evening sir, I am by name timothy N Balam from Jibel. Sir,
there is a problem in our polling unit. Voters for APGA were not allowed to vote
except for APC and PDP. They brought in Fulani and said nobody will vote for
APGA because he (Maku) is Eggon by tribe. They went and brought warriors with ammunition
to kill us. I as APGA agent escaped narrowly because they ran after me and I thank
God for saving me.
“For that we were not allowed to vote for APGA by the Fulani
warriors because they were having weapons.
“Thanks, I remain Timothy N Balam, agent APGA, Arikaya/Mankwar Ward Unit 19, Jibel,” he
concluded.
